Output e31e3abed3b6728fb83269f530701e54ae92ee67bb9d6fc95c50d8e656e51f0a:0

value
28053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b7aed03d606b5f68a726f46f49bea80b9aab90 OP_EQUAL
address
3JSRdA7W58NatW6DNPbpGGdhb7qT9mapJ9
transaction
e31e3abed3b6728fb83269f530701e54ae92ee67bb9d6fc95c50d8e656e51f0a